Output f66a538df9ab784cdca225b1bb511f85548fa7c140f5b9ac022c275de2c94209:0

value
238238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8511a62054477ad37cf41bf2d0bc8bcddd00c931 OP_EQUAL
address
3DpcwKtJ987nKSvMbwXWioMDttkEjuTUWk
transaction
f66a538df9ab784cdca225b1bb511f85548fa7c140f5b9ac022c275de2c94209
confirmations
223513
spent
true